2014 Toyota Venza
Critical Failure Risk
Supplemental Restraint System (SRS) wiring in the driver-side door can become damaged, potentially preventing side and curtain airbags from deploying. This is a significant safety recall.
Early detection can help you avoid a $400-$700 repair.

What are the NHTSA safety ratings for the 2014 Toyota Venza?
NHTSA ratings: Overall 5/5 • Frontal 4/5 • Side 5/5 • Rollover 4/5.
